Key Partnerships


The strategic alliances that CDW Corporation has nurtured are pivotal to its operational excellence and customer service objectives. These partnerships enable the company to offer a comprehensive catalog of products and ensure efficient delivery systems.

Technology Vendors: Collaboration with leading hardware manufacturers like HP, Apple, and Dell empowers CDW to provide a wide range of technological equipment that addresses the diverse needs of its clientele. This partnership ensures that CDW has access to the latest technological innovations, competitive pricing, and direct manufacturer support, enhancing the value delivered to end-users.

  • HP brings a vast array of printing and personal computing products.
  • Apple contributes premium products known for their innovation and design.
  • Dell offers robust computing solutions and enterprise products.

Software Providers: Partnerships with software giants such as Microsoft and Adobe are essential for provisioning comprehensive software solutions to CDW customers. These collaborations help in bundling value-added services, training, and technical support, enhancing product functionality and user satisfaction.

  • Microsoft provides a suite of software products and cloud solutions that are crucial for business environments, including Office 365 and Azure.
  • Adobe's suite of creative and document management software is vital for multimedia and creative sectors.

Logistics and Shipping Companies: By partnering with reliable logistics and shipping firms, CDW ensures that products are delivered in a timely and efficient manner. This is particularly crucial in maintaining service levels and customer satisfaction, as well as in managing supply chain dynamics.

  • These partnerships facilitate both national and international shipping, enabling CDW to serve a global customer base effectively.
  • Strategic logistics collaborations also allow for cost-effective shipping solutions, which play a significant role in competitive pricing.

Networking Solution Providers: Networking solutions are vital for the seamless operation of the technologies provided. CDW’s alliances with specialized network solution providers ensure that businesses not only receive the hardware and software but also get the necessary network support to fully utilize their technological investments.

  • This includes both physical networking hardware like routers and switches, as well as software-defined networking solutions and services.
  • These partnerships also enable CDW to offer customized solutions based on specific business needs, enhancing customer reliability and trust.

Each of these partnerships is crucial in facilitating a robust business model for CDW, enabling it to maintain its status as a leading provider of integrated IT solutions. Through these strategic alliances, CDW not only leverages the core competencies of its partners but also enhances its own market offering, driving business growth and customer satisfaction.

Customer Segments


CDW Corporation tailors its technology solutions and services to meet the diverse needs of various customer segments, reflecting a strategic approach to market penetration and customer satisfaction. These segments include large enterprises and corporations, small and medium-sized businesses, government and education sectors, and healthcare providers. Understanding the unique needs and challenges of these segments enables CDW to offer precise, effective solutions.

Large Enterprises and Corporations

  • Complex IT solutions: This segment requires sophisticated, scalable technology solutions that can support extensive operational networks and massive data management needs.
  • Customized service: CDW provides tailored services, including enterprise software, hardware, and comprehensive IT infrastructure management that align with the strategic goals of large organisations.
  • Global support: Given their often global presence, large corporations benefit from CDW’s ability to support multinational operations with consistent service levels and systems integration across borders.

Small and Medium-Sized Businesses (SMBs)

  • Cost-effective solutions: SMBs typically require affordable, value-driven technology solutions that provide high returns on investment without the complexity that larger corporations might need.
  • Critical support and guidance: CDW offers expertise in selecting and implementing appropriate technology that matches the scale and operations of SMBs, helping them to optimize operations and grow their businesses.
  • Managed Services: To alleviate the pressure on in-house IT resources, CDW provides managed services that handle regular IT administration tasks, such as network management, data backup, and cybersecurity.

Government and Education Sectors

  • Regulatory compliance: This segment requires solutions that adhere strictly to legal and regulatory standards. CDW specializes in providing compliant, secure, and effective technology systems that honor these constraints.
  • Education technology: For educational institutions, CDW delivers technology that enhances teaching and learning environments through innovative tools and platforms that support digital classrooms and remote learning.
  • Cost efficiency: Given budgetary constraints common in this sector, CDW offers competitively priced solutions designed to maximize taxpayer contributions without compromising on quality or capability.

Healthcare Providers

  • Medical-grade technology: Healthcare clients require specialized, compliant, and secure technology solutions suitable for medical environments, which CDW provides.
  • Healthcare IT infrastructure: Robust IT solutions that support large volumes of confidential data and 24/7 operations are critical in this sector. CDW’s offerings ensure reliability and accessibility vital for patient care and medical services.
  • Data management and security: With the sensitivity of patient data, CDW emphasizes advanced security protocols and systems to protect data against breaches while facilitating easy access for medical professionals.

By recognizing and addressing the specific challenges and requirements of these diverse customer segments, CDW effectively positions itself as a versatile and essential partner in technology solutions across industries.

Revenue Streams


The revenue model of CDW Corporation is diversified across several streams, primarily focusing on the direct sales of IT products and services, fees from IT consulting and solutions implementation, maintenance and support service contracts, and commissions from partnerships with technology providers. This multi-channel revenue strategy ensures a steady income flow from multiple sources, optimizing financial stability and growth potential.

  • Direct Sales of IT Products and Services: CDW generates a significant portion of its revenue from the direct sale of IT products, including hardware like servers, personal computers, networking equipment, and software solutions such as security applications and enterprise software. The company caters to a variety of sectors, including business, government, education, and healthcare, tailoring IT solutions to meet industry-specific needs.
  • Fees from IT Consulting and Solution Implementation: Another vital revenue stream for CDW is the fees it charges for professional IT consulting and implementation services. This includes the design and deployment of complex IT infrastructures, cloud computing solutions, and the integration of various technology systems. CDW specialists work closely with client organizations to assess their technological requirements and deliver customized, efficient solutions that align with their strategic goals.
  • Maintenance and Support Service Contracts: CDW offers ongoing maintenance and support services, which are critical for the seamless operation of IT systems. This revenue stream is bolstered by long-term service contracts that provide predictable income and foster strong customer relationships. Services typically include 24/7 tech support, hardware and software upgrades, troubleshooting, and other proactive maintenance tasks.
  • Commissions Earned from Partnerships with Technology Providers: CDW collaborates with various technology providers and earns commissions by selling third-party IT products and services. These partnerships allow CDW to offer a more comprehensive product portfolio, including the latest technological innovations that may be beyond the scope of its own inventory. The commission-based model not only enhances CDW's product offerings but also incentivizes the company to align its sales strategies with the technological trends and demands of the marketplace.
